Zusatztext ** '(An) imaginative tale Informationen zum Autor Chris Brookmyre was a journalist before becoming a full time novelist with the publication of QUITE UGLY ONE MORNING. Since the publication of A BIG BOY DID IT AND RAN AWAY he and his family decided to move away from Aberdeen and now live near Glasgow. Klappentext * Bad language. Scatalogical humour. Razor wit.
